From 35c36a67607044ae98cbb69370a1fa00dbf0bbd3 Mon Sep 17 00:00:00 2001 From: Hanno Becker Date: Tue, 23 Apr 2019 12:31:42 +0100 Subject: [PATCH] Guard CID implementations by MBEDTLS_SSL_CID --- library/ssl_tls.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/library/ssl_tls.c b/library/ssl_tls.c index a22437a01..50464751c 100644 --- a/library/ssl_tls.c +++ b/library/ssl_tls.c @@ -118,6 +118,7 @@ static void ssl_update_in_pointers( mbedtls_ssl_context *ssl, #if defined(MBEDTLS_SSL_PROTO_DTLS) +#if defined(MBEDTLS_SSL_CID) /* Top-level Connection ID API */ /* WARNING: This implementation is a stub and doesn't do anything! @@ -150,6 +151,7 @@ int mbedtls_ssl_get_peer_cid( mbedtls_ssl_context *ssl, *enabled = MBEDTLS_SSL_CID_DISABLED; return( 0 ); } +#endif /* MBEDTLS_SSL_CID */ /* Forward declarations for functions related to message buffering. */ static void ssl_buffering_free( mbedtls_ssl_context *ssl );